Chocolate-chip Pumpkin Muffins (yes, the chocolate part comes first as it is most important…:))

INGREDIENTS:

2 1/2 cups all-purpose flour

1 cup sugar or 3/4 cup brown sugar

1/2 cup whole wheat flour

1 1/2 teaspoons baking powder

1 1/2 teaspoons ground cinnamon

1 teaspoon salt

1/2 teaspoon baking soda

1/2 teaspoon ground nutmeg

3 eggs

1 (15 ounce) can solid pack pumpkin

3/4 cup applesauce

1 cup semisweet chocolate chips*

DIRECTIONS:

In a mixing bowl, combine the first eight ingredients. In another bowl, combine egg, egg substitute, pumpkin, applesauce and oil; stir into dry ingredients just until moistened. Stir in chocolate chips. Coat muffin cups with nonstick cooking spray; fill two-thirds full with batter. Bake at 400 degrees F for 18-22 minutes or until a toothpick comes out clean. Cool for 5 minutes before removing from pans to wire racks.

*Or, you can try putting a bit of nutella swirled either on the top of the muffins each individually before you bake them, or fill each cup halfway with batter, put about a teaspoon of nutella on them, then fill the rest of the way with batter.
